Cheonggye Mountain Gondre House
06802 1 Cheongnyongmaeul 1-gil, Seocho-gu, Seoul 2층"The essence of Gondre rice infused with the flavors of Cheonggye Mountain, 'Cheonggye Mountain Gondre House'" Located at the entrance of Cheonggye Mountain in Seocho-gu, Seoul, 'Cheonggye Mountain Gondre House' is a renowned specialty restaurant for Gondre rice that brings the healthiness of nature to your table. This place offers a particularly special experience for hikers, boasting a rich and deep flavor from the fresh Gondre greens combined with abundant perilla oil. The Gondre rice is prepared immediately upon order, and the dipping sauce and thick soybean paste served with the warm rice add to the enjoyment of mixing it all together. Especially, the tofu and soybean paste stew here is a delicacy, always made with fresh ingredients that deliver a deep and rich taste. Additionally, the basic side dishes of fresh salad and pickled vegetables complement the Gondre rice, creating a more fulfilling meal. Although it can get quite busy on weekends with long waiting lines, it is relatively easier to enjoy on weekday evenings, making it even more recommended. Ridooburo
06806 7 Wonter 4-gil, Seocho-gu, SeoulBusiness Hours 10:00 ~ 21:00"A Tofu Specialty Restaurant Capturing the Flavors of Cheonggye Mountain, 'Ridooburo'" Located at the entrance of Cheonggye Mountain in Seocho-gu, Seoul, 'Ridooburo' is a renowned restaurant that boasts fresh tofu dishes made from domestically sourced soybeans. Once known as 'Risum Tofu', it has recently undergone a renewal to present a fresh new look. Thanks to its proximity to nature, this place is perfect for visitors after a hike, and it is particularly loved by those seeking a healthy meal. The signature dish at Ridooburo is the bean noodle soup, made with a rich soy milk created by harmoniously blending black and white soybeans, offering a deep and savory flavor. The cold bean noodle soup, perfect for summer, tantalizes the taste buds even in the heat, and its smooth noodles provide an unforgettable experience. Additionally, the side dishes of perilla leaves and seaweed salad enhance the meal's overall flavor. Not only does this place serve tofu dishes, but it also offers a variety of menus that can be enjoyed with traditional liquors, making it an ideal gathering spot for friends and family. With friendly service and a pleasant atmosphere, Ridooburo has established itself as a beloved dining spot not just for hikers but also for locals. Cheongnyu Byeok
06621 29 Seocho-daero 74-gil, Seocho-gu, SeoulBusiness Hours 11:00 ~ 21:30"A special culinary experience at 'Cheongnyu Byeok', a famous restaurant in Gangnam" 'Cheongnyu Byeok' is a popular restaurant located near Gangnam Station, specializing in high-quality meats and unique noodle dishes. It offers a variety of meticulously prepared menus using domestic Hanwoo beef and pork. Notably, the Jeobok Jeongban is a signature dish that captivates meat lovers, providing the joy of enjoying fresh meat alongside various types of kimchi. Another charm of Cheongnyu Byeok is the 'Perilla Oil Makguksu'. Made with freshly pressed perilla oil from the store, this makguksu maximizes its nutty flavor and has become very popular among those who crave a savory taste with chewy noodles. Eating it with a variety of vegetables can create a healthy meal. The interior of the restaurant exudes a cozy and vibrant atmosphere, and thanks to the quick table turnover, waiting times are generally short. Although it can get busy on weekends or during dinner hours, the anticipation of delicious and hearty food makes the wait worthwhile.
